Related QuestionsHow do I select which ISO setting to use?
EVOLT E-510 > Frequently Asked QuestionsThink of the ISO values as film speeds. Low ISOs such as 100 and 200 are better suited to situations in which there is a lot of light ? outdoors scenes. Higher ISOs, such as 400 and 800, would be used outdoors where there is plenty of light and fast shutter speeds are desired ? sports and air shows, for example ? or indoors for available light shooting. ISO 1600 would be used where there are very low light levels, such as indoors or at night.
Related QuestionsWhy use the self-select PIN?
Free File: Frequently Asked QuestionsThe self-select PIN is a paperless process using electronic signatures. This method allows you to electronically sign your e-filed return by selecting a five-digit PIN. The five-digit PIN can be any five numbers except all zeros and eliminates the requirement for mailing to the IRS, the Form 8453, U.S. Individual Income Tax Declaration for an IRS e-file Return. When the self-select PIN is chosen, no signature documents are required to be mailed to the IRS making the process truly paperless.

Related QuestionsWhat music can we use in the films?
Film Racing | frequently asked questionsAny music used in the film must have express written consent in the form of a music release from the owner / composer of the music. If you have someone composing an original soundtrack for the film, you need their release. If you have song from a friend's band, you need their release. If you have a song from a royalty free program or website, you need to provide paperwork that shows that it is royalty free. Music releases can be downloaded for each city.

Related QuestionsWhich DEET concentration should I use? What product should I select?
Frequently Asked Questions About DEETDEET-based insect repellents are available in a range of concentrations from5 percent to 100 percent. A 5 percent product will provide approximately 90 minutes of protection and a 100 percent product approximately 10 hours. The "effective" time increases as you increase the concentration of DEET. Generally, the longer you are outside, the higher the concentration you should use.

What does the Admission Committee use as criteria to select applicants admitted to the DVM program?
Admission FAQsAcademic and nonacademic qualifications are considered in the selection process. Selection for admission is based on the sum of two scores: an objective score which comprises approximately 60-70 percent of the final calculation and a subjective score which comprises the remainder. The objective evaluation is based on scholastic achievement and standardized test scores. Official transcripts of college course grades are examined to determine scholastic achievement.
